C2H5Cl has a low melting point.its melting point is around -138.7 degree celcius,which is camparatively very low.

hence option (A) is correct.

C2H5Cl is a covalent compound not ionic.because there are covalent bonds between C and H, between C and Cl etc.

hence option (B) is incorrect.

Option (C) is also incorrect,as explained above.

Its solubility in water is 0.447 g/100 mL and also its a covalent compound not a ionic compound thats why its not a strong electrolyte.

hence,option (D) is incorrect.

Yes,this compound is stable in molecular form,hence we can say that its a molecular compound.

option (E) is correct.
